| The problem is that sometimes the WB loads and the "whdload starting... Please wait!" prompt stays forever, without launching the game. If I quit the emulator and start again the same game, or double click again the same game while waiting for the first launch to start, the game starts as supposed to do and everything is OK...?!

Does this problem (1) always happen with whdload games, (2) happen with specific whdload games, or (3) at random with any whdload game.
You should not EVER see the message "whdload starting... Please wait!". Instead of "whdload" you should see the name of your game. That you are seeing this suggests that something is quite wrong with your RunInUAE installation, although I am not sure what yet.
Quote:
| P.S. I have WHDLoad v17.0.5139 |
Does this mean that you installed WHDLoad (v17.0) on OS4? That is a VERY BAD thing to do, and I would not be at all surprised if it broke RunInUAE's WHDLoad handling. RunInUAE installs a "fake" WHDLoad command, so installing the real WHDLoad on top of it will thus break that.
WHDLoad must be installed *inside* E-UAE, to the Workbench3.1 installation.

Great to know ! WHDLoad 17.1 is also on the way, for more info check: http://whdload.de/whdload/
That fix a couple of annoying problems, expecially this one:
Quote:
- fix: if the vbr is moved by WHDLoad the interrupts of levels 4-6 (vectors $70..$78) are directly forwarded to the installed program now, in previous releases all the sanity checks and checks for the keyboard were done in each interrupt which has increased the latency and duration of the interrupts, now these checks are only performed in interrupt levels 1-3 or if the option CheckInts/S is used for all levels it seems that the increased amount of code put into the interrupts by the later WHDLoad versions has caused problems with several games, this is hopefully fixed now and these games will work with the current WHDLoad as good as with versions 16.8 or 16.9 |

| Just so people know: Cass found that his WHDLoad game problem was because he was starting WHDLoad games using iGame.
I have now found & fixed the iGame problem for the next release of RunInUAE, so you will be able to use iGame (again). _________________ Author of the PortablE programming language. I love using Amiga OS4.1 on my A1-X1000 & Sam440  Don't forget the official support forum for OS4! |
